Merge tag 'net-6.6-rc7' of git://git.kernel.org/pub/scm/linux/kernel/git/netdev/net
Pull networking fixes from Jakub Kicinski:
"Including fixes from bluetooth, netfilter, WiFi.
Feels like an up-tick in regression fixes, mostly for older releases.
The hfsc fix, tcp_disconnect() and Intel WWAN fixes stand out as
fairly clear-cut user reported regressions. The mlx5 DMA bug was
causing strife for 390x folks. The fixes themselves are not
particularly scary, tho. No open investigations / outstanding reports
at the time of writing.
Current release - regressions:
- eth: mlx5: perform DMA operations in the right locations, make
devices usable on s390x, again
- sched: sch_hfsc: upgrade 'rt' to 'sc' when it becomes a inner
curve, previous fix of rejecting invalid config broke some scripts
- rfkill: reduce data->mtx scope in rfkill_fop_open, avoid deadlock
- revert "ethtool: Fix mod state of verbose no_mask bitset", needs
more work
Current release - new code bugs:
- tcp: fix listen() warning with v4-mapped-v6 address
Previous releases - regressions:
- tcp: allow tcp_disconnect() again when threads are waiting, it was
denied to plug a constant source of bugs but turns out .NET depends
on it
- eth: mlx5: fix double-free if buffer refill fails under OOM
- revert "net: wwan: iosm: enable runtime pm support for 7560", it's
causing regressions and the WWAN team at Intel disappeared
- tcp: tsq: relax tcp_small_queue_check() when rtx queue contains a
single skb, fix single-stream perf regression on some devices
Previous releases - always broken:
- Bluetooth:
- fix issues in legacy BR/EDR PIN code pairing
- correctly bounds check and pad HCI_MON_NEW_INDEX name
- netfilter:
- more fixes / follow ups for the large "commit protocol" rework,
which went in as a fix to 6.5
- fix null-derefs on netlink attrs which user may not pass in
- tcp: fix excessive TLP and RACK timeouts from HZ rounding (bless
Debian for keeping HZ=250 alive)
- net: more strict VIRTIO_NET_HDR_GSO_UDP_L4 validation, prevent
letting frankenstein UDP super-frames from getting into the stack
- net: fix interface altnames when ifc moves to a new namespace
- eth: qed: fix the size of the RX buffers
- mptcp: avoid sending RST when closing the initial subflow"
